Saudi Pro League champions

Despite Cristiano Ronaldo’s remarkable performance during the latter part of the 2022-23 season, Al-Nassr narrowly missed out on capturing the Saudi Pro League title, ultimately securing the second position in the standings. They finished five points behind the champions, Al-Ittihad, as reported by Reuters.

However, in the wake of their recovery from the disappointments of the previous season, Al-Nassr has embarked on a promising start to the new campaign. After nine league matches, they currently hold the third spot in the league standings, trailing the top position by a mere four points. Notably, Ronaldo has been the standout performer, leading the charts as the top scorer in the Saudi Pro League this season, with an impressive tally of 10 goals.

Should he maintain this level of goal-scoring prowess and lead Al-Nassr to a league title, it would significantly bolster his prospects of securing a sixth Ballon d’Or award.

Euro 2024 champions

Ronaldo has successfully found the back of the net nine times and provided an assist in seven Euro qualifiers this year. His scoring prowess remains at its peak, and he is expected to lead Portugal’s offensive line in the forthcoming competition scheduled for next year.

If Portugal manages to clinch the title in the 2024 Euros, it would mark a significant addition to Ronaldo’s trophy cabinet. Moreover, if his individual achievements align with this team success, he could firmly establish himself as a formidable candidate for the Ballon d’Or award.
